Hi Marc,

I still can't import the private key and I have 51.973444 BTC. I see the balance on blockchain.info but something is corrupt with my bitcoinqt client and I cannot transfer the BTC.

Here is a zip attached with my wallet.dat, and the password. ************ Can you please transfer the BTC to the following address : ************************** ?

Thanks alot you save my life !

My name is surely not Marc.
Question is this... is this a new form of scam/virus related on bitcoin?
The link brings to a zipped file called walletBTC.zip
And why in the world I would send them to him? I'm like... keep them for myself, right?
Should I try to open it in a safe zone aka linux machine and be curious like a cat to know what the hell he sent to me or should I simply delete the email and let it go forever like it never happened?

Ok guys, what I found inside using my linux machine:
a .Ink file that contains a password and an exe kind file. I tried to extract it and i find inside UPX0 and UPX1 file, plus some folder like bitmap etc etc... you want the file? I give you the file so you can inspect it.
Beware don't open it if you aren't using gloves or security protection.
Don't use it on a machine where it contains your wallet or important stuff. a virtual machine without internet connection is fine.
